class httk.atomistic.sites.Sites(reduced_coords: httk.core.VectorLike)[source]

The sites of a crystal structure: the Nx3 matrix of reduced coordinates, held exactly.

Reduced (fractional) coordinates are the symmetry-native frame: point-group operations are integer matrices and translations are rationals, so no radicals ever appear. They are therefore stored as an exact rational FracVector of shape (N, 3). A Sites object is iterable and indexable over its length-3 coordinate rows (each a FracVector), with len giving the number of sites.

Inputs embed exactly: rationals (and rational-valued floats), rational strings, and numpy arrays all land on their exact rational value. An irrational SurdVector input is reduced deterministically through the vector family’s fractions hub (never raising on data); the exact Cartesian frame — where radicals belong — is obtained instead via cartesian_sites().

property reduced_coords: httk.core.FracVector[source]

The Nx3 reduced site coordinates as an exact FracVector (one site per row).

numeric() httk.atomistic.numeric_sites.NumericSites[source]

A plain-numpy presentation of these sites (requires the httk-atomistic[numpy] extra).
